Output 663687cdc429a21f529631d43b236dbac1437ba98d2a42a561ad1cef447ddb8c:0

value
13589754
script pubkey
OP_0 OP_PUSHBYTES_20 af3626ffa9e6f18bdca1ebd8fa6ff2b8184cd593
address
bc1q4umzdlafumcchh9pa0v05mljhqvye4vn27v8v2
transaction
663687cdc429a21f529631d43b236dbac1437ba98d2a42a561ad1cef447ddb8c
spent
true